Q: What outgassing properties does Titanium Threaded Blind Stud (Interior) have in vacuum environments? ▼
Grade 2 CP-Ti exhibits outgassing rates below 1×10⁻¹² Torr·L/s·cm² after bake-out at 200°C for 4 hours, compliant with SEMI F3 and ASTM E595 requirements. Total mass loss (TML) <0.1% and collected volatile condensable materials (CVCM) <0.01% per ASTM E595. This makes Titanium Threaded Blind Stud (Interior) suitable for chamber interior threaded in UHV processing chambers down to 1×10⁻¹⁰ Torr.
